  • a turnout is a line connection device used in rail transit to transfer a rolling stock from one lane to another, usually at the intersection of the throat or two lines of the station.
  • the track of medium and low-speed maglev rail transportation usually includes a ballast beam, a truss beam, a trolley, a beam upper rail, a driving device, a locking device, a movable end rail, and an electric control system.
  • the control of the electrical system is performed.
  • the locking device is unlocked, and the ballast beam is moved from one track to another under the action of the driving device. After the movable end track is flush with the track on the truss beam, the locking device locks and completes the conversion of the ballast.
  • the medium and low speed maglev track ballast usually adopts an articulated magnetic floating track.
  • the joint type magnetic floating raft generally has an active beam and a plurality of driven beams, a fork device between the active beam and the driven beam or between the driven beam and the driven beam, and is a driven beam of the joint type magnetic floating raft An important part of the ability to rotate.
  • the driving device of the ballast will rotate the active beam with the center of rotation as the center of rotation.
  • the ballast active beam passes through the fork device to drive the ballast and the driven beam to rotate together, thereby realizing the transition of the ballast direction.
  • the existing ballast fork device has a complicated structure on one hand, and is difficult to manufacture and manufacture. On the other hand, its structure is remarkable, so that the frictional resistance is large during the shifting process, which not only makes the mechanism wear more, but more seriously it makes The driven beam rotates slowly with the active beam, and the rotation is not smooth enough, resulting in low efficiency and may affect the smoothness of the track.

道岔是轨道交通中用于使机车车辆从一股道转入另一股道的线路连接设备,通常在车站咽喉区或两条线路的交汇处铺设。中低速磁浮轨道交通的道岔通常包括有道岔梁、垛梁、台车、梁上导轨、驱动装置、锁定装置、活动端导轨、电气控制系统,在列车需要变道时,通过电气系统的控制,锁定装置解锁,道岔梁在驱动装置的作用下,由一个股道移动到另一个股道,活动端轨道与垛梁上的轨道平齐对接以后,锁定装置进行锁定,完成道岔的转换工作。
中低速磁浮轨道道岔通常采用关节型磁浮道岔。这种关节型磁浮道岔一般有一个主动梁和多个从动梁,主动梁与从动梁之间或者从动梁与从动梁之间的拨叉装置,是关节型磁浮道岔的从动梁能够进行转动的重要组成部分。当磁浮列车需要变道时,道岔的驱动装置会使主动梁以转动中心为圆心进行转动,道岔主动梁通过拨叉装置,带动道岔从动梁一起进行转动,从而实现道岔方向的转换。
现有的道岔拨叉装置其一方面结构复杂,制造加工难度大,另一方面是其结构显著使得在拨叉过程中摩擦阻力大,不仅使得机构磨损较大,更为严重的是其在使得从动梁随主动梁转动中速率慢,而且转动不够顺畅,导致效率过低而且可能会对轨道平顺产生影响。

图1-4为按照本发明一个优选实施例的拨叉装置的结构示意图。本实施例中的拨叉装置包括拨叉铰机构和拨叉单元两部分,其中拨叉铰机构与主动梁固定连接,拨叉单元与从动梁13固定连接,拨叉铰机构设置在拨叉单元上,主动梁被驱动而转动会驱动拨叉铰机构转动,从而带动拨叉单元转动进而驱动从动梁随动,实现拨叉换道。
如图1和2所示,本实施例的拨叉铰机构包括防护盖1、铰轴2、滑套3、自 润滑减摩套4、自润滑减摩板5、托板6、底座7,其中,铰轴2为柱体,其垂直设置在底座7上,即一端固定在底座7上,优选铰轴与底座是一体设置,铰轴2另一端面设置有防护盖1。底座7通过例如螺栓与主动梁固定连接,主动梁绕转动中心的转动可以驱动铰轴一起转动。
如图1所示,铰轴2上同轴由内之外依次套装有减摩套4、滑套3以及减摩板5,具体地,铰轴2外周同轴套接有减摩套4,自润滑减摩套4外周同轴套接滑套3,滑套3外周同轴套接减摩板5。
其中,优选减摩套4与铰轴2固定套接或者呈较大摩擦阻力的紧密连接,使得铰轴2的转动(绕主动梁转动中心)可以使得减摩套4同步或者呈相对滑动地随动。
滑套3优选与减摩套4呈具有一定摩擦力的同轴套接,其可以使得减摩套4转动是即依靠两者之间的滑动摩擦使减摩套4带动滑套3绕主动梁转动,同时可能存在绕自身轴向的转动。这种方式可以使得滑套3与减摩套4的磨损减小,而且转动更为顺畅。
相应地,自润滑减摩板5优选与滑套3呈相对固定或者呈具有一定摩擦力的可相对滑动的同轴套接,使得滑套3的转动可以带动自润滑减摩板5随同转动,可能是同步转动,或者是不同步的转动。
在一个实施例中,优选减摩套4与减摩板5均为自润滑的,即自润滑减摩套和自润滑减摩板。
在一个实施例中,优选减摩套4与减摩板5的材料为高力黄铜。
滑套3、减摩套4和减摩板5优选均由托板6设置在底座7上,而底座7优选由固定螺栓8固定在主动梁上。
拨叉单元包括拨叉板10和底座板12,其中拨叉板10由底座板12固定在从动 梁13上。如图3和4所示,拨叉板10整体呈一定厚度的板体,其从从动梁13端部伸出,且伸出端前端中部开口,两边形成两支腿,该开口部用于拨叉铰机构的铰轴2以及套装在其上的滑套3、减摩套4和减摩板5穿过,使得拨叉板10通过其两腿10与拨叉铰机构的减摩板5接触而与拨叉板连接,这样当减摩板5转动时,通过摩擦力可以驱动拨叉板10的两腿以及拨叉板10随动。
如图4所示,在一个实施例中,拨叉板10的两腿的每支腿呈中空的截面为方形的柱体结构,其与减摩板通过其内侧面的接触面板接触,使得其与减摩板的接触为面接触。
在一个实施例中,支腿为非中空,或者支腿截面为圆形或其他形状。
在一个实施例中,拨叉铰机构插在拨叉板10伸出的两腿中间后,通过固定钢板连接两支腿,并将钢板由螺柱11和螺母9固定在拨叉板两腿的前端,使得拨叉铰机构不能从拨叉单元的拨叉板中滑出。
当磁浮列车需要变道时,道岔的驱动装置会使主动梁以转动中心为圆心进行转动,由于拨叉铰机构固定在主动梁上,因此主动梁转动时,会带动拨叉铰机构上的铰轴2转动,铰轴2带动滑套3以及减摩板5转动,进而减摩板带动支腿以及拨叉板10转动,拨叉板10固定在从动梁13上的,因此从动梁10也会随主动梁一起转动。
拨叉装置中使用了自润滑减摩套4和自润滑减摩板5,使得在拨叉过程中由于摩擦阻力减小,主动梁带动从动梁13的转动更为顺畅,拨叉铰机构的磨耗减小,提高了拨叉装置的使用寿命。
